
About Liz Claiborne
In 1976, a relatively unknown dress designer, her textile veteran husband, a merchant and a production expert, founded a company that would revolutionize the fashion industry – from how women dress for work, to how it is sold into and at department stores to where product is sourced. The partners, Liz Claiborne, Art Ortenberg, Leonard Boxer and Jerome Chazen each invested $50,000 in personal savings and borrowed an additional $200,000 from friends and family to found what is today a nearly $5 billion public company.
